The Stupid Message at the Beginning of the Book

 It’s a good thing you’re reading this book. Because if you don’t read this book all the way through to the end, your head might fall off.

Which is exactly what happened to Vincent Newman. Vincent said, “No way. I’m not gonna read that book,” and then…

PLOP!

His head fell off and rolled into a field, where some dogs played soccer with it.

The final score was Bulldogs 7, Mutts 5.

 Close game.

Too bad Vincent didn’t really get to see it. 

When Jessica Phillips ignored this book, her ears turned into antlers.

It was all pretty shocking, especially when her family started hanging their coats on Jessica.

Miss Joy, one of the best librarians anywhere, recommended this book to Danny Valenti.

But he turned it down.

Within minutes, his rear end grew to the size of an elephant’s—which made it very hard for him to lie on his bed without his trunk hitting the ceiling.

(Oh yes, he had also grown a trunk.)

Rachel Brown thought about reading this book, but she decided she didn’t like its cover. Now that Rachel’s arms are 17 feet long, she realizes that it’s true —you can’t tell a book by its cover.

 Jordan Williams, who refuses to read any book, anywhere, anytime, passed up the chance to read this one and he now has a blooming shrub where he used to have hair.

It’s pretty, and the birds like it, but it’s kinda itchy.

A whole second grade class in Connecticut told their teacher they didn’t want to read this book, and now each kid is fruit-shaped. 

Billy, the banana in the second row, wishes he could be a pineapple.

No one knows exactly why turning down this book has such a powerful effect on people. 

But it never fails.

Avoid this book and you’ll face certain trouble.

Ask Vincent…

Or Jessica… 

Or Danny… 

They all wish they’d read this book. 

The good, good, good, good news is nothing that happened to any of them will happen to you. 

Your head won’t fall off. 

And you won’t grow strange or unusual body parts. 

You are 1,000,000,000% safe. 

Because you have been smart enough to read this book. 

Just be sure you read the whole book. 

To the very last word… on the very last page. 

Because nothing bad can happen to you if you read all the way through the whole book 

Seriously. 

THE END… FOR NOW
